When it comes to Tax then Residents of Spain are Taxed by their Region like Murcia or Valencia, for example, but non Residents of Spain are Taxed by the central Tax office in Madrid. Even if the deceased of a property is Resident of Spain and the Benefisheries are not then the Benefisheris still have to pay Inheritance Tax to Madrid not the Region where the property is located. This is the case whether the property is on mainland Spain or the Canaries or Balearic's and irrelevant of Nationality unless Spanish.
